SUPPORTING HARDWARE CONFIGURATION CHANGES IN A UEFI FIRMWARE COMPONENT
First Claim
1. A method for customizing a build configuration of a Unified Extensible Firmware Interface (UEFI) compatible, comprising:
- modifying the build configuration of the UEFI compatible component to reflect modifications to a first file by performing;
(A) receiving a configuration parameter;
(B) creating, using the configuration parameter, a configuration parameter symbol pointing to the first file; and
(C) replacing, using the configuration parameter symbol, the first file with a second file, wherein the second file includes modifications to the first file, and wherein the modifications support a functionality desired by a user.
6 Assignments
0 Petitions
Accused Products
Abstract
A method and apparatus for providing support for customization of a build configuration of a Unified Extensible Firmware Interface (UEFI) compatible component. The method includes modifying the build configuration of the UEFI compatible component to reflect modifications to a first file. A configuration parameter is received. The configuration parameter is used to create a configuration parameter symbol pointing to the first file. The first file is replaced with a second file, which includes modifications to the first file. The modifications support a functionality desired by a user.
21 Citations
20 Claims
-
1. A method for customizing a build configuration of a Unified Extensible Firmware Interface (UEFI) compatible, comprising:
modifying the build configuration of the UEFI compatible component to reflect modifications to a first file by performing; (A) receiving a configuration parameter; (B) creating, using the configuration parameter, a configuration parameter symbol pointing to the first file; and (C) replacing, using the configuration parameter symbol, the first file with a second file, wherein the second file includes modifications to the first file, and wherein the modifications support a functionality desired by a user.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
12. A system for providing support for customization of a build configuration of a Unified Extensible Firmware Interface (UEFI) compatible component, comprising:
-
one or more processors; and memory having instructions encoded therein, the instructions when executed by the one or more processors perform a method including; modifying the build configuration of the UEFI compatible component to reflect modifications to a first file by performing; (A) receiving a configuration parameter; (B) creating, using the configuration parameter, a configuration parameter symbol pointing to the first file; and (C) replacing, using the configuration parameter symbol, the first file with a second file, wherein the second file includes modifications to the first file, and wherein the modifications support a functionality desired by a user. - View Dependent Claims (13, 14, 15, 16, 17)
-
-
18. A computer-readable medium having instructions encoded therein, the instructions when executed by one or more processors perform a method comprising:
modifying a build configuration of a Unified Extensible Firmware Interface (UEFI) compatible component to reflect modifications to a first file by performing; (A) receiving a configuration parameter; (B) creating, using the configuration parameter, a configuration parameter symbol pointing to the first file; and (C) replacing, using the configuration parameter symbol, the first file with a second file, wherein the second file includes modifications to the first file, and wherein the modifications support a functionality desired by a user. - View Dependent Claims (19, 20)
Specification